Subject: Quickstore 4.2 — bloom filter now fronts the KV layer

Plugin authors: starting with this release, Quickstore places a bloom filter ahead of the key-value store. Negative lookups return faster; false positives fall through safely. No API changes are required on your side. Verify your plugin against the staging build referenced below.

session token of fahif-tadup = htk3_9c7

**Mgmt Meeting Minutes — Retiring the Brightline Range**

Quick recap for sales leads at Fenholt Supplies: we agreed to retire the Brightline fixture range by year-end. Remaining stock moves to clearance pricing next month, and accounts on standing orders get migrated to the Lumetta range. Trade-in incentives were approved in principle. The confidential note on next steps sits just below.

board note of bajof-bajeg: The pricing group signed off on a budget of $13.4 million for Project Sildor. The renewal with Lamixek Holdings closes at $48.9 million a year, 49 percent above the last contract.

This year's training spend came in 6% under allocation, largely due to deferred Helixpath certification cohorts. For next year, Finance proposes a modest uplift of 9%, weighted toward technical upskilling and the new Brightmoor leadership track. Department heads should submit prioritised training plans before the planning cycle closes; unfunded requests will be reviewed case by case. All figures remain provisional pending board ratification. The confidential planning note underpinning these allocations is recorded below.

management briefing: The renewal with Quenathox Group closes at $10 million a year, 20 percent below the last contract. Project Ulawyn slips by two quarters because of the supplier delay.

Minutes — Management Meeting, Hallward Instruments

Attendees agreed the Corvex meter line will be retired by end of Q3. Remaining stock moves to clearance channels; service commitments run twelve months further. Marla Denniker will brief distributors next week. For the incoming director's awareness, retirement frees capacity at the Ostbruck plant. The confidential rationale for that capacity is noted below.

management briefing: Project Ulavan slips by two quarters because of the staffing delay.